Giants Videos | New York Giants – Giants.com
Interviews
WR Sterling Shepard on missed opportunities
Sterling Shepard discusses missed opportunities in Sunday's loss in Philadelphia
Sterling Shepard discusses missed opportunities in Sunday's loss in Philadelphia